Installing Your System
1. Camera installation
1.1. Camera placement
Field of view – Cameras must be positioned so they can effectively view the entire area that
must be monitored, and in a location that makes tampering with it difficult.
Lighting – Direct sunlight shining on the camera lens or bright reflections from shiny objects
in the field of view can diminish video quality and camera performance. Mount the camera in
shaded areas, if possible, or where these influences can be minimized.
Ease of installation – Must be able to install the camera at the location, considering
mounting hardware requirements, temperature, dust, moisture, etc.
1.2 Mounting
1. Using the camera bracket mounting assembly plate as a template, mark the location of
the holes for the mounting screws on the mounting surface.
2. Drill holes into the mounting surface for the mounting screws, wall inserts, or other
attachment hardware as needed.
3. If you are routing the video/power drop cable through the mounting surface, drill a hole

near the mounting plate for the drop cable.
4. Attach the mounting bracket to the mounting surface using appropriate fasteners.
5. Attach the camera with the mounting bracket.
6. Point the camera at your surveillance target, then tighten the lock nuts to hold it in place.
(Note: The direction the camera is pointing may need correction when video from the camera
is observed.)
7. Route the camera drop cable through the hole drilled for it in the mounting surface, if used.
If the camera is installed where moisture may accumulate on it, leave a “drip loop” in the
cable so that beads of water on the cable slide away from the camera and the drop cable
connectors.
8. Attach a video/power extension cable to the camera drop cable (see diagram below). Note:
When connecting the video cables, fully rotate the lock ring to hold them together.
9. Route the other end of the video/power extension cable to the DVR backpanel.
10. Repeat this procedure for all of the cameras you are installing.

2.1 BNC Connector
BNC is an abbreviation for Bayonet-Neil-Concelman. It is an industry standard for

transmitting a video signal over a coaxial cable. It features a unique locking mechanism to
ensure the cable is firmly secured to the DVR/monitor and will not come loose.

3.2 DVR placement
Your monitoring and recording equipment is central to constant surveillance and the reliable
capture of video evidence. SecurityIng strongly suggests that it be installed in a secure
location with access limited to authorized personnel.
DVRs generate heat and should be placed in a ventilated area. A high temperature
environment will reduce the life span and reliability of the equipment. Additionally, the DVR

is not weatherproof, so avoid exposure to liquids and excessive dust. Do not place objects
along the sides or behind the DVR that will block airflow through the unit.
